I finaly secured a location for the International Bowhunter Education Class on the S. E. side of the state. :hello:
It will be over just out of Walla Walla on July 24th and 25th. This is a 2 day class. anyone from any state can attend and get certified for hunting with a bow anywhere in the world. :IBCOOL: Limited space as uasual so send me a pm and I'll let you know how you can sign up.

We include Calling ,tracking ,blood trailing, :o The history of modern bowhunting , Conservation, Survival, First aid, Shot placement, Capeing, Skinning, Tree stand saftey , We check out your equipment, Broad head testing, and much , much more!
The class is 15.00 and lasts 2 days.
